This book studies a different type of sands from the coast: El Oualidia and El Jadida in the DOUKKALA region (Morocco). Our sand samples have been physico-chemically characterized by analytical techniques such as sieve granulometry, mineralogy and X-ray diffraction (XRD). These analyses revealed that the main component found for these sands is silicon dioxide (SiO2), with the presence of impurities (iron, clay and organic matter). The objective of this research is to gain a deeper understanding of the behavior of cement mortar made with the sands studied as a base.
